There are three parts to this recipe that come together so sweetly and deliciously–the apple mixture, the bread mixture, and the glaze.

Apples: I used Granny Smith apples for the recipe because they remain firm when baking. They won’t turn to mush and they tend to retain their shape when baked. A few other options you could try would be Honeycrisp apples, Braeburn, Fuji, or Pink Lady apples.

Biscuits: Look for the flaky variety of buttermilk biscuits. Or, you could also use Rhodes Rolls (like I did in my Orange Monkey Bread recipe).

Generally, monkey bread is made in a bundt pan. But, you can definitely use a different type of pan to get the same delicious Apple Fritter Monkey Bread. You could use a casserole pan. But, the cooking times could vary when you are using a different pan. Be sure to check the middle of the bread for doneness. A bread pan or springform pan would also work.

Yes! This recipe is easy to put together the day ahead of baking. Simply follow all of the instructions up to placing the bread into the oven. Cover the rolls and store them in the refrigerator until the next day. Then, bake the bread when you are ready.

Store the baked bread in the refrigerator, covered, for up to 2 days. When ready to enjoy, simply pop it in the microwave to warm it up.

To begin, preheat the oven to 350℉. While the oven preheats, generously grease a bundt pan with butter or cooking spray. Then, peel, core, and dice the apples into 1/4 inch pieces. I used Fuji apples for this recipe, but you can use any apple you like, such as Gala, Pink Lady, or Granny Smith.

Put the diced apples in a medium-sized mixing bowl and toss them with lemon juice to prevent the apples from browning. Then sprinkle them with two tablespoons of granulated sugar and one teaspoon of ground cinnamon.

Tasty Dishes In Less Time

Add the apple mixture to a skillet with one tablespoon of butter and saute over medium heat until the apples are soft and cooked through.

Next, combine the granulated sugar and cinnamon in a small bowl and mix well. Gently drop the pieces of dough into the bowl and cover each piece with the cinnamon-sugar mixture. Alternate between adding layers of the diced apple and dough pieces in the bundt pan.

Then, in a small saucepan, add one cup unsalted butter, 1/2 cup brown sugar, and 1/2 cup of the remaining cinnamon-sugar mixture. Stir gently and bring to a boil. Once the sugar has dissolved, drizzle the sauce over the bundt pan.

Carefully remove the pan from the oven and allow the monkey bread to rest for approximately 5 minutes. Then, invert the bundt pan onto a large plate.

To make the glaze, mix one cup of powdered sugar with 1-2 tablespoons of milk and 1/4 teaspoon of vanilla extract. Drizzle over the monkey bread and serve warm.

Leftovers are not likely. But, on the off chance that it doesn’t get devoured immediately, place the extra monkey bread in an airtight container and refrigerate.
